国家知识产权局信息显示,晶科能源(海宁)有限公司申请一项名为"硼扩散方法、太阳能电池的制备 方法"的专利,公开号CN121057349A,申请日期为2025年10月。 专利摘要显示,本申请涉及太阳能电池技术领域,特别是涉及一种硼扩散方法、太阳能电池的制备方 法,能够减少硅片的翘曲度,硼扩散方法包括:提供半成品硅片,所述半成品硅片包括依次层叠设置的 硅基底、隧穿氧化层、非晶硅膜层;在第一温度下对所述非晶硅膜层进行晶化处理,使所述非晶硅膜层 转换为多晶硅膜层;降温至第二温度,在所述第二温度下对所述半成品硅片进行氧化处理;在从所述第 二温度升温至第三温度的过程中进行沉积处理;从所述第三温度升温至第一温度,在所述第一温度下对 所述半成品硅片进行推结处理。 作者:情报员 声明:市场有风险,投资需谨慎。本文为AI基于第三方数据生成,仅供参考,不构成个人投资建议。 本文源自:市场资讯 天眼查资料显示,晶科能源(海宁)有限公司,成立于2017年,位于嘉兴市,是一家以从事电力、热力 生产和供应业为主的企业。企业注册资本357000万人民币。通过天眼查大数据分析,晶科能源(海宁) 有限公司参与招投标项目56次,专利信息823条, ...

国家知识产权局信息显示,拉普拉斯新能源科技股份有限公司申请一项名为"一种太阳能电池及其制备 方法和光伏组件"的专利,公开号CN120692963A,申请日期为2025年06月。 专利摘要显示,本发明提供一种太阳能电池及其制备方法和光伏组件。所述制备方法包括以下步骤:采 用等离子体增强化学气相沉积法,在硅基底的一侧表面上形成第一减反层;采用物理气相沉积法,在所 述第一减反层远离所述硅基底的表面上形成第二减反层。本发明采用等离子体增强化学气相沉积法沉积 第一减反层,采用物理气相沉积法沉积第二减反层,两种方法配合使用,极大地减弱了电池到组件的严 重色差,消除了等离子体增强化学气相沉积法带来的卡点印,提高了电池和组件良率,实现了全黑的黑 光伏组件设计。 天眼查资料显示,拉普拉斯新能源科技股份有限公司,成立于2016年,位于深圳市,是一家以从事电气 机械和器材制造业为主的企业。企业注册资本40532.6189万人民币。通过天眼查大数据分析,拉普拉斯 新能源科技股份有限公司共对外投资了10家企业,参与招投标项目59次,财产线索方面有商标信息122 条,专利信息686条,此外企业还拥有行政许可57个。 ...

Core Viewpoint - Jinko Solar (Haining) Co., Ltd. has applied for a patent related to solar cell technology, indicating ongoing innovation in the solar energy sector [1] Company Summary - Jinko Solar (Haining) Co., Ltd. was established in 2017 and is located in Jiaxing City, primarily engaged in the production and supply of electricity and heat [1] - The company has a registered capital of 357 million RMB [1] - Jinko Solar (Haining) has participated in 56 bidding projects and holds 709 patent records, along with 72 administrative licenses [1] Patent Details - The patent application, titled "Solar Cell and Its Manufacturing Method, Stacked Battery, Photovoltaic Module," was filed on June 2025 and published under CN120417551A [1] - The technology involves doping antimony to enhance carrier concentration and optimize carrier transport efficiency, which improves the fill factor of the solar cells [1] - The method controls the concentration of antimony in the first semiconductor layer to be greater than that in the second layer, optimizing electrical performance and enhancing passivation effects [1]
